Publisher: Self-published by Desert Diamond Crochet

Number of Pages: 49 pages

Number of Projects: 6

Types of Projects: Animal hats….and all the features to make them detailed.

Difficulty: All hats are made with sc to make it easier for a new crocheter.

Yarn Used: #4 worsted weight

First Impression: Lots of details!

Favorite Project: I couldn’t choose one favorite, but I narrowed it down to two. The giraffe and the dinosaur.

Hatimals - GiraffeGiraffe

Review: It may seem like there are only a small number of projects, but Rebecca, from Desert Diamond Crochet, has included all sizes from infant through adult. There is so much detail put into each feature. (If you’re adventurous you could probably even come up with your own wacky combo creature!) Rebecca has also included general information (gauge, terms, abbreviations), as well as assembly help and care instructions.
